Crush that competition! Lin "ET" Chia-hung, a Taiwanese e-sports titan, proved his metal yet again at EVO Japan 2025, bagging his second consecutive King of Fighters XV title in a row.
In a gripping showdown featuring Japan's pro-gaming juggernaut "mok," Lin emerged victorious with a thrilling 3-1 win in the grand final. Interestingly, Lin scored an identical 3-1 victory against mok in the winners' final – a repeat performance to remember.
Taking home a whopping ¥1 million (approximately US$6,897), Lin left the two-day tournament buzzing with 294 competitors in its wake. The second-place finisher, mok (Lin's toughest rival), pocketed a consolatory ¥400,000.

Given that mok was Lin's primary thorn in the King of Fighters XV bracket, it's intriguing to note that Lin stays undefeated against him in set competitions, boasting an impressive 10-0 record. Out of the 30 games they've played, Lin has only lost six – showcasing his dominance in their head-to-head battles.
Lin commenced his professional fighting game quest back in 2013. Despite capturing his first tier-1 title at EVO Japan last year, he marked this year's championship as his second major career triumph.
